Water-Efficient Pipes Fixtures

Water-efficient plumbing fixtures can greatly minimize your house's water usage, aiding you preserve this priceless resource and lower your utility expenses.

These components, which include toilets, showerheads, and taps, are developed to use substantially less water than their typical equivalents.

Many of them integrate smart modern technology, such as sensing units and flow-control mechanisms, to specifically regulate water use.

Tankless Water Heater Conveniences

One essential advantage of a tankless hot water heater is that it can supply a continuous supply of hot water, ensuring you never ever run out all of a sudden.

Tankless modern technology heats up water only when you require it, instead of keeping a storage tank warmed constantly. This on-demand strategy means you won't throw away energy keeping a container of hot water that may go extra. In fact, tankless water heaters can be approximately 34% more energy-efficient than traditional tank-style designs, resulting in considerable energy cost savings over time.

One more benefit of tankless heating systems is their small size. Without a bulky tank, they can be mounted in tight areas, maximizing important square video footage in your house.

Furthermore, tankless models tend to have longer life-spans than tank heaters, commonly lasting two decades or more with proper upkeep. This longevity, integrated with the power cost savings, makes a tankless hot water heater a clever investment for house owners aiming to improve their home's effectiveness and ease.

Greywater Recycling Solutions

While tankless water heaters use excellent power effectiveness, an additional method to increase your home's sustainability is by executing a greywater reusing system.

Greywater - the fairly tidy wastewater from sinks, showers, and cleaning makers - can be collected, dealt with, and reused for non-potable applications like bathroom flushing and landscape watering. This not just lowers your freshwater consumption yet also decreases your energy prices connected with water heating.

The installment of a greywater system involves pipes alterations to divert greywater from the main drainpipe line. The collected water is then filtered, disinfected, and stored in a holding storage tank for later emergency plumbing services usage.

While the in advance investment may be higher than a traditional pipes configuration, the long-term cost savings on your energy costs can make it a rewarding upgrade. And also, you'll have the contentment of doing your component to save this valuable resource.

Updating Water Fixtures

Updating your home's water fixtures is an additional vital step in enhancing its power efficiency. Changing older, ineffective models with contemporary, water-saving choices can considerably reduce your water intake and the connected power expenses.

When it comes to fixture materials, try to find durable and sustainable choices like stainless-steel or brass. These materials not only elevate the aesthetic of your restroom and kitchen area however likewise assure lasting efficiency.

Pay close attention to flow rates when picking new components. Low-flow showerheads, faucets, and commodes can considerably reduce your water usage without jeopardizing convenience or capability. Aim for components with flow rates of 1.5 gallons per minute (GPM) or less for faucets and 2.0 GPM or less for showerheads.

Renewable Energy and Pipes

The junction of renewable resource and pipes offers house owners possibilities to boost their home's power effectiveness and decrease their environmental influence.

One means to do this is with solar heating unit, which utilize the sunlight's energy to warmth water for your home. By incorporating these systems with your pipes, you can reduce your reliance on traditional hot water heater, conserving you cash on energy bills and reducing your carbon footprint.

One more renewable resource choice is rainwater harvesting. By setting up a rainwater collection system, you can record and store rain for later usage in your plumbing, such as for commode flushing or outdoor watering. This not just reduces your demand for municipal water, however it additionally aids to reduce the pressure on regional water sources.
